Ventura County Workplace Safety Violations – What to Do
If you have a safety problem in Ventura County, it is essential to respond. To begin, document everything thoroughly, like instances, events, the specifics of the issue. Then, think about submitting the matter to OSHA. You may in addition lodge a complaint the county authorities if you suspect a serious offense is involved. Consulting an attorney is very recommended, especially if you are worried about negative consequences.
Knowing Family & Medical Leave in Ventura County: Are You Able?
Ventura County individuals seeking leave from work for important reasons may be qualified to protections under the Family and Medical Leave Act (FMLA) and California Family Rights Act (CFRA). Determining your eligibility involves several factors. Generally, you must have been employed for a certain period of time for your employer, typically at least 12 year(s), and have performed at least 1,250 hours during the preceding 12 timeframe. Your employer must also meet business requirements - typically having 50 or more individuals within a 75-mile radius. Approved reasons for leave include caring for a recently born child, supporting a loved member with a severe health ailment, or dealing with your own grave health condition. For more specifics and to investigate your unique situation, consider contacting the California Department of Fair Employment and Housing (DFEH) or consulting with an work specialist.
